Centered in the northern part of the Las Vegas Valley near Rancho High School and surrounding residential communities, the Rancho area provides ArchWell Health members with access to local recreation centers, parks for walking, wellness programming, and easily reachable community gatherings.
A pivotal hub is the Silver Mesa Recreation Center, which holds a dedicated Senior Social Seniors Club for ages 55+. This center hosts an array of activities including card games, billiards, walking track, fitness room, Zumba, sewing or ceramics, drawing and painting, piano keyboard classes, and occasional group trips such as Valley of Fire outings or PBS station tours—all aimed at keeping members physically and socially active.
In addition, nearby Clark County-operated facilities like Parkdale Recreation & Senior Center (at Desert Inn and Boulder Hwy) provide senior-only hours and programming Monday through Friday. Amenities include fitness rooms, classrooms, game rooms, and social clubs—plus health seminars and craft workshops.
Outdoor movement and gentle exercise can be enjoyed at neighborhood parks: while North Las Vegas parks are more dispersed, residents may explore walking loops at Centennial Hills Park (approx. 120 acres) or other local community green spaces that offer shaded benches and open lawns for peaceful outdoor breaks. Cooking and healthy-living education may be offered within the senior club programs or rotating monthly events—centers often host informal nutrition demonstrations, themed luncheons, and wellness presentations as part of their Active Adult programming.
For broader enrichment, Active Adults services across Las Vegas neighborhood centers (especially Doolittle, Howard Lieburn, and West Flamingo) offer local adult fitness programs, arts & crafts, technology workshops, computer classrooms, trips, social groups, and low-cost healthy cooking demos.
